monitoimijayhteistyö
Monitoimijayhteistyö, a Finnish term, translates to multi-stakeholder cooperation. It refers to a collaborative approach where various actors, including governmental bodies, private sector entities, non-governmental organizations, and civil society, work together towards common goals. This form of cooperation is often employed to address complex societal challenges that cannot be effectively solved by a single entity acting alone.
The core principle of monitoimijayhteistyö is the pooling of resources, expertise, and perspectives from diverse stakeholders.
